Which Shopify Themes Are Actually ADA Compliant?
TABLE OF CONTENTS
- Key Takeaways
- What Makes a Shopify Theme ADA Compliant?
- Shopify Online Store 2.0 Theme Rankings
- How to Evaluate Theme Accessibility
- Beyond Theme Selection: Achieving Full Compliance
- Why Accessibility Overlays Don't Make Themes Compliant
- Theme Accessibility Checklist
- Frequently Asked Questions
- Related Resources
Choosing an ADA compliant Shopify theme is the foundation of building an accessible e-commerce store. With over 4,500 web accessibility lawsuits filed annually and the Department of Justice confirming that the ADA applies to websites, Shopify merchants face real legal and business risks from inaccessible storefronts. However, not all themes marketed as "accessible" deliver on that promise. Many free and premium themes contain fundamental accessibility barriers that no amount of configuration can fix. This guide reviews Shopify themes for genuine accessibility, explains what makes a theme compliant, and provides a framework for evaluating any theme's accessibility before you commit.
Key Takeaways
Understanding what makes a Shopify theme ADA compliant helps you avoid costly mistakes and legal exposure.
- No Shopify theme is 100% ADA compliant out of the box—even the best require proper configuration and content management
- Shopify's Online Store 2.0 themes (Dawn, Craft, Sense, Crave, Refresh) offer the strongest accessibility foundations
- Theme accessibility is just the starting point—apps, customizations, and content can introduce barriers regardless of theme quality
- Key accessibility features to evaluate: keyboard navigation, focus visibility, color contrast, semantic HTML, and ARIA implementation
- Source code remediation is often necessary to achieve full compliance, even with accessible theme foundations
What Makes a Shopify Theme ADA Compliant?
ADA compliance for websites means conforming to the Web Content Accessibility Guidelines (WCAG), which courts and regulators consistently reference as the technical standard. For a Shopify theme to be considered compliant, it must meet WCAG 2.1 Level AA success criteria across all its components and templates.
Essential Accessibility Features
Keyboard Navigation: Every interactive element—links, buttons, form fields, dropdown menus, modals, and carousels—must be fully operable using only a keyboard. Users who cannot use a mouse rely on Tab, Enter, Space, and arrow keys to navigate.
Focus Visibility: When users tab through your site, a visible focus indicator must show which element is currently selected. This indicator should meet contrast requirements (3:1 minimum) and be clearly visible against all backgrounds.
Color Contrast: Text must have sufficient contrast against its background—4.5:1 for normal text and 3:1 for large text. This applies to all text including navigation, buttons, product descriptions, and form labels.
Semantic HTML: Themes must use proper HTML elements for their intended purpose: headings for structure (H1-H6 in logical order), lists for grouped items, buttons for actions, and links for navigation.
Form Accessibility: All form fields need visible labels programmatically associated with inputs. Error messages must be clear, specific, and announced to screen readers.
Image Alt Text Support: The theme must provide fields for alt text and render them correctly. Product images, banners, and decorative elements need appropriate handling.
Skip Navigation: A "skip to content" link should be the first focusable element, allowing keyboard users to bypass repetitive navigation.
ARIA Implementation: When HTML alone is insufficient (for dynamic content, custom widgets, or complex interactions), ARIA attributes must be used correctly to communicate state and purpose to assistive technologies.
Common Accessibility Failures in Themes
Many Shopify themes fail accessibility in predictable ways:
- Dropdown menus that don't work with keyboards
- Missing or inadequate focus indicators
- Low contrast text, especially on hero images and buttons
- Carousels without keyboard controls or pause functionality
- Modals that trap focus or can't be closed with Escape
- Product variant selectors that don't announce changes
- Mobile menus that aren't accessible
- Cookie consent banners that block interaction
Shopify Online Store 2.0 Theme Rankings
Shopify's first-party themes, rebuilt for Online Store 2.0, represent the best starting point for accessible stores. Shopify has invested significantly in accessibility for these themes, though none achieve perfect compliance without additional work.
Tier 1: Strongest Accessibility Foundations
Dawn (Free) Dawn is Shopify's flagship reference theme and has the most mature accessibility implementation. Key strengths include:
- Consistent, visible focus indicators
- Keyboard-accessible mega menus
- Proper heading hierarchy on all templates
- ARIA live regions for cart updates
- Good color contrast in default settings
- Skip navigation link
Accessibility considerations: Some contrast issues with default accent colors, product image galleries require testing, and quickview functionality may need attention.
Refresh (Premium - $350) Built on Dawn's foundation with additional accessibility refinements:
- Enhanced focus styles
- Improved form validation messaging
- Better mobile navigation accessibility
- Strong default contrast ratios
Accessibility considerations: Custom sections and blocks may introduce issues depending on configuration.
Tier 2: Good Accessibility with Known Issues
Sense (Free) Designed for high-imagery brands, Sense offers:
- Solid keyboard navigation
- Visible focus states
- Semantic structure
Accessibility considerations: Text over images can create contrast issues, and some interactive elements need focus improvements.
Craft (Free) Craft provides:
- Clean semantic HTML
- Adequate keyboard support
- Good form accessibility
Accessibility considerations: Some color combinations don't meet contrast requirements, and the mobile menu has minor issues.
Crave (Free) Crave offers:
- Functional keyboard navigation
- Basic focus indicators
- Reasonable structure
Accessibility considerations: Focus visibility could be stronger, and some animations may affect users with vestibular disorders.
Tier 3: Premium Themes Requiring More Work
Premium themes from the Shopify Theme Store vary significantly in accessibility quality. Before purchasing, evaluate:
Impulse (Premium): Known for good accessibility foundations but requires contrast adjustments and focus improvements.
Prestige (Premium): Luxury styling often conflicts with accessibility requirements. Contrast and keyboard navigation need attention.
Warehouse (Premium): B2B focus but accessibility varies by section. Catalog pages generally accessible, but some widgets are problematic.
Broadcast (Premium): Visual design prioritizes aesthetics over accessibility. Significant remediation typically required.
How to Evaluate Theme Accessibility
Before committing to any theme, conduct your own accessibility evaluation. Here's a systematic approach.
Keyboard-Only Testing
- Open the theme demo in a browser
- Unplug or disable your mouse
- Press Tab repeatedly to navigate through the entire page
- Verify you can reach every interactive element
- Check that focus order is logical (left-to-right, top-to-bottom)
- Test that focus indicators are always visible
- Use Enter/Space to activate buttons and links
- Test dropdown menus with arrow keys
- Verify you can close modals with Escape
- Navigate the mobile menu in responsive view
Automated Testing
Run automated accessibility tools on the theme demo:
Browser Extensions:
- axe DevTools (Chrome/Firefox)
- WAVE (Chrome/Firefox)
- Lighthouse Accessibility Audit (Chrome DevTools)
Note: Automated tools catch roughly 30% of accessibility issues. A clean automated report doesn't mean the theme is compliant, but automated failures definitely indicate problems.
Screen Reader Testing
Test with at least one screen reader:
- Windows: NVDA (free) with Chrome or Firefox
- Mac: VoiceOver (built-in) with Safari
- Mobile: VoiceOver (iOS) or TalkBack (Android)
Key tests:
- Navigate by headings—is structure logical?
- Are images described appropriately?
- Do form fields have clear labels?
- Are buttons and links announced with their purpose?
- Are cart updates and status messages announced?
Contrast Checking
Use tools to verify color contrast:
- WebAIM Contrast Checker
- Chrome DevTools color picker (shows contrast ratio)
- TPGi's Colour Contrast Analyser
Check:
- Body text against backgrounds
- Navigation links
- Button text
- Form field text and borders
- Error and success messages
- Text over images
Beyond Theme Selection: Achieving Full Compliance
Selecting an accessible theme is necessary but not sufficient for ADA compliance. Multiple factors beyond the theme affect your store's accessibility.
Apps and Integrations
Every Shopify app you install can introduce accessibility barriers. Common problematic categories:
- Pop-up and email capture apps: Often keyboard inaccessible and trap focus
- Review apps: Widget accessibility varies widely
- Chat widgets: Many fail keyboard navigation
- Social proof notifications: May not be dismissible or may cause distraction issues
- Upsell/cross-sell apps: Product carousels often inaccessible
Before installing any app, test its accessibility on a development store.
Theme Customizations
Custom code added to your theme can undermine its accessibility:
- Custom sections may lack proper semantics
- CSS changes can break focus visibility
- JavaScript modifications may remove keyboard support
- Custom fonts may not include all character weights
Content Accessibility
Your content determines much of your accessibility compliance:
- Product images need descriptive alt text
- Videos need captions and transcripts
- PDFs must be tagged for accessibility
- Color choices in images and graphics must meet contrast requirements
- Link text must be descriptive (not "click here")
Source Code Remediation
For stores that need to achieve compliance quickly and comprehensively, source code remediation addresses accessibility at the code level. Unlike overlay widgets that add a layer on top of inaccessible code, source code remediation fixes the actual HTML, CSS, and JavaScript that cause accessibility barriers.
TestParty's source code remediation for Shopify identifies and fixes accessibility issues in your theme's code, ensuring that screen readers, keyboards, and other assistive technologies can properly interpret and interact with your store.
Why Accessibility Overlays Don't Make Themes Compliant
Some merchants consider adding accessibility overlay widgets to address compliance concerns. This approach has significant limitations:
Overlays can't fix structural issues: If a theme uses divs instead of buttons, an overlay can't change the underlying HTML that screen readers interpret.
Overlays often introduce new problems: Many overlays interfere with assistive technologies that users already have configured.
Overlays don't provide legal protection: Thousands of lawsuits have been filed against websites using accessibility overlays. Courts have consistently held that overlays don't constitute genuine accessibility.
Major disability organizations oppose overlays: The National Federation of the Blind, American Council of the Blind, and other advocacy organizations have issued statements against overlay technology.
For genuine accessibility, the source code itself must be accessible. Starting with a well-built theme and addressing issues through proper remediation is the only reliable approach.
Theme Accessibility Checklist
Use this checklist when evaluating any Shopify theme:
Navigation
- [ ] Main menu fully keyboard accessible
- [ ] Dropdown/mega menus work with arrow keys
- [ ] Mobile menu keyboard accessible
- [ ] Focus indicator visible on all navigation items
- [ ] Skip to content link present and functional
Product Pages
- [ ] Image gallery keyboard navigable
- [ ] Variant selectors accessible and announce changes
- [ ] Add to cart button properly labeled
- [ ] Quantity adjusters keyboard accessible
- [ ] Product information uses proper heading hierarchy
Cart and Checkout
- [ ] Cart updates announced to screen readers
- [ ] Quantity changes accessible
- [ ] Remove item buttons properly labeled
- [ ] Checkout forms have visible labels
- [ ] Error messages are specific and associated with fields
Visual Design
- [ ] Default colors meet contrast requirements
- [ ] Focus indicators have 3:1 contrast
- [ ] Text remains readable when zoomed to 200%
- [ ] Content reflows at 320px width
Interactive Elements
- [ ] All modals can be closed with Escape
- [ ] Carousels can be paused
- [ ] Accordion/tab components keyboard accessible
- [ ] No keyboard traps anywhere on site
Frequently Asked Questions
Is there a fully ADA compliant Shopify theme?
No Shopify theme is 100% ADA compliant out of the box. Even the best themes like Dawn require proper configuration, accessible content (especially alt text), and evaluation of any apps or customizations. Shopify's first-party themes provide the best foundation, but achieving compliance requires ongoing attention to content and functionality.
Does Shopify guarantee theme accessibility?
Shopify does not guarantee that any theme meets specific accessibility standards. While Shopify has improved accessibility in their first-party themes and provides accessibility guidelines for theme developers, the company explicitly does not certify themes as ADA or WCAG compliant.
Can I make any theme accessible?
Theoretically, yes, but practically it depends on the theme's architecture. Themes with fundamental structural problems may require such extensive modification that starting with a more accessible theme is more cost-effective. Themes using modern, semantic HTML are easier to remediate than those relying on complex, non-standard markup.
How much does it cost to make a Shopify theme accessible?
Costs vary significantly based on the theme's starting point and your store's complexity. A basic audit might cost $500-2,000, while comprehensive remediation can range from $5,000-25,000+ for complex stores. Using an accessible theme foundation and addressing issues proactively is more cost-effective than remediating a problematic theme after launch.
Should I choose a free or paid theme for accessibility?
Shopify's free Online Store 2.0 themes (Dawn, Sense, Craft, Crave, Refresh) often have better accessibility than many premium themes. The investment Shopify has made in accessibility for these themes exceeds what many third-party developers provide. Evaluate any theme on its actual accessibility merits, not its price point.
How often should I test my theme for accessibility?
Test after any significant change: theme updates, new app installations, custom development, or major content updates. Conduct comprehensive audits at least annually. Use automated testing tools regularly (weekly or monthly) to catch regressions.
Related Resources
- Best Shopify Accessibility Tool 2025
- Complete Shopify Accessibility Guide
- WCAG Level AA Checklist 2026
- Shopify Accessibility Checklist
This article was crafted using a cyborg approach—human expertise enhanced by AI to provide practical guidance on selecting and evaluating Shopify themes for ADA compliance based on WCAG 2.1 Level AA requirements and real-world testing experience.
Stay informed
Accessibility insights delivered
straight to your inbox.


Automate the software work for accessibility compliance, end-to-end.
Empowering businesses with seamless digital accessibility solutions—simple, inclusive, effective.
Book a Demo